Michael Leunig was an iconic Australian cartoonist, writer, painter, philosopher and poet, best known for his cartoons published in the Sydney Morning Herald and Age newspapers over 55 years. Spanning the political, cultural and philosophical, his visual world was one of whimsy, wit and a deep humanity.

‘Untitled (Read all about it)’ is an original ink drawing, quintessentially Leunig. With his signature blend of deadpan humour and philosophical sadness, Leunig sketches a collapsing world: the economy is a disgrace, the environment a tragedy, society in tatters – and yet, amid the wreckage, a quiet figure offers the final punchline: “Lots and lots of juicy stories. Read all about it.” Satirical, spare, and striking, this work is a critique of the media frenzy and a meditation on the human tendency to consume collapse as entertainment. Part lament, part commentary, this is a powerful work for those who appreciate the delicate balance of humour and despair that defined Leunig’s art.
